Typical Day
07:30 Juice or herbal tea, chai, fruit salad
08:00 Morning energising Yoga practice (we will typically start with some meditation and/or pranayama and then move into a more dynamic asana practice)
10:00 Yummy Brunch
11:00 Free time – swimming, blissful massage, walking, exploring, or simply just relaxing!
16:00 Evening lunar Yoga practice (Yin Yoga, Restorative Yoga, breathing, meditation, manta and Yoga Nidra, with a backdrop of the ocean at sunset)
18:00 Sunset
19:00 Delicious Dinner – vegetarian buffet
About Deborah

Deborah has been practicing Yoga since 2000 and literally ‘fell in love’ from her first class. Experiencing the immediate health benefits of a healthy, supple and more vibrant body, this sparked her interest in yogic philosophy and a desire to find a deeper experience and meaning in everything – she just got interested in life! Although she’s a thoroughly modern yogi – present to the challenges of contemporary life, her practice and teaching is deeply influenced by the beautiful philosophies and great mystical teachings of Yoga’s rich history.
She has been teaching since 2007, embracing ad exploring different traditions including alignment-based Dynamic Yoga, Ashtanga, Vinyasa Flow, Hatha, Yin Yoga, Restorative Yoga, Yoga Nidra, Mindfulness Meditation and Pranayama (breathing exercises). Her classes are spacious, intuitive and inclusive, and always with a sense of lightness and humour. Yoga and laughing are not mutually exclusive!
She teaches all levels – from beginners’ classes to teacher training – and has plenty to offer everyone, regardless of age, size, gender, fitness, diet and lifestyle. She is accredited by both British Wheel and Yoga Alliance (Senior Yoga Teacher) and owns Whitespace Yoga Studio in the UK.
